Handy information about Murtala Muhammed International Airport (LOS)
Of all flights departing from Murtala Muhammed International Airport, 64.68% arrive as scheduled at their destination.
To reach Murtala Muhammed International Airport from central Lagos, it takes around 30 minutes if you're going by car. Of course, this depends on traffic. It's approximately 14 kilometres from the airport to the city centre.
The journey on public transport takes roughly 1 hour 30 minutes.

Getting from Julius Nyerere International Airport (DAR) to central Dar Es Salaam
From Julius Nyerere International Airport, Dar Es Salaam is approximately 11 kilometres away. It takes around 30 minutes to reach the centre driving.
When to fly to Julius Nyerere International Airport (DAR)
It's time to work out your dates for your flight from Murtala Muhammed International Airport to Julius Nyerere International Airport. July is the busiest month to head to Dar Es Salaam. If you're after a more low-key vibe, go in February.
Before locking in your flight from Murtala Muhammed International Airport to Julius Nyerere International Airport, consider the type of weather you like. March is the warmest month in Dar Es Salaam, with the temperature ranging from 23ºC (73ºF) to 33ºC (91ºF).
July sees average temperatures of between 20ºC (68ºF) and 29ºC (84ºF). Look for cheap tickets from LOS to DAR sometime then if you like travelling in cooler conditions.
